About Dawn E. Kelley
Dawn E. Kelley is a scholar working on Molecular Biology, Immunology, Radiology, Nuclear Medicine and Imaging, Cancer Research and Ecology, having authored 46 papers that have together received 5.9k indexed citations. Recurring topics across this work include RNA Research and Splicing (24 papers), RNA and protein synthesis mechanisms (23 papers), RNA modifications and cancer (17 papers), Monoclonal and Polyclonal Antibodies Research (7 papers), T-cell and B-cell Immunology (6 papers), DNA and Nucleic Acid Chemistry (6 papers), Glycosylation and Glycoproteins Research (5 papers) and Genomics and Chromatin Dynamics (5 papers). The work is most often cited by research in Molecular Biology (4.7k citations), Immunology (897 citations), Cancer Research (546 citations), Radiology, Nuclear Medicine and Imaging (633 citations) and Genetics (567 citations). Dawn E. Kelley has collaborated with scholars based in United States and Canada. Frequent co-authors include Robert P. Perry, Jay Greenberg, Narayanan Hariharan, J.L. La Torre, Karen H. Friderici, Fritz Rottman, Ueli Schibler, Jèssica Latorre, Christopher Coleclough and C. Coleclough. Their work appears in journals such as Journal of Molecular Biology, Cell, Proceedings of the National Academy of Sciences, Molecular and Cellular Biology and Journal of Cellular Physiology.
